概括
抗菌素耐药性是一个日益增长的威胁. 针对细菌GroEL/ES系统,一个关键的分子陪伴者,为开发新型抗生素来对抗感染提供了一个有希望的新策略.

背景情况:
- 传染病对全球健康造成重大负担,由于抗生素的不适当使用而导致广泛的抗菌素耐药性加剧了这种负担.
- 传统的药物发现方法在开发新抗生素以对抗不断发展的细菌耐药性方面取得了有限的成功.
- 迫切需要新的抗菌策略来应对延迟药物开发和新兴耐药性的挑战.
研究的目的:
- 审查细菌GroEL/ES系统的功能,一个关键的分子陪伴者.
- 总结针对GroEL/ES系统的现有抑制剂.
- 突出GroEL/ES系统作为新型抗生素开发的潜在药物标.
主要方法:
- 关于细菌分子伴侣素的研究文献综述,特别是GroEL/ES系统.
- 对针对GroEL/ES系统的化合物及其抗菌活性研究的分析.
- 综合有关GroEL/ES在细菌活力和蛋白质折叠中的作用的信息.
主要成果:
- GroEL/ES系统对于细菌生存至关重要,在压力条件下调解正确的蛋白质折叠.
- 针对GroEL/ES的化合物已经显示出抗菌活性.
- 抑制转录和翻译机制,包括沙佩罗宁,是一种有效的抗菌策略.
结论:
- GroEL/ES系统代表了一个有希望的和验证的药物标,用于开发新的抗生素.
- 向分子沙佩罗宁为克服现有的抗菌素耐药性提供了一种新的策略.
- 对GroEL/ES抑制剂的进一步探索可能会导致针对细菌感染的有效治疗方法.

Molecular Chaperones and Protein Folding
17.7K
The native conformation of a protein is formed by interactions between the side chains of its constituent amino acids. When the amino acids cannot form these interactions, the protein cannot fold by itself and needs chaperones. Notably, chaperones do not relay any additional information required for the folding of polypeptides; the native conformation of a protein is determined solely by its amino acid sequence. Chaperones catalyze protein folding without being a part of the folded protein.
